States are needed to supply oral advantages to youngsters covered by Medicaid and the Children's Health and wellness Insurance policy Program (CHIP), however mentions pick whether to offer dental advantages for grownups. See the 2010 Medicaid/CHIP Oral Health and wellness Solutions truth sheet for info on youngsters's access to dental services and possibilities and challenges to obtaining care - dentist Oklahoma City.

Oral testing may be part of a physical examination, it does not substitute for an oral assessment done by a dentist. A recommendation to a dentist is needed for each child according to the periodicity schedule established by a state. Dental solutions for kids must minimally include: Relief of pain and infectionsRestoration of teethMaintenance of dental healthThe EPSDT benefit needs that all solutions have to be supplied if identified clinically essential.


If a condition needing therapy is discovered throughout a testing, the state has to supply the essential services to treat that condition, whether such services are included in a state's Medicaid plan. Each state is needed to create a dental periodicity routine in assessment with identified dental organizations associated with kid healthcare.

Oral protection in separate CHIP programs is called for to consist of coverage for dental solutions "required to stop condition and promote oral health, recover dental frameworks to health and function, and deal with emergency conditions."States with a different CHIP program may select from 2 alternatives for offering oral insurance coverage: a package of oral advantages that meets the CHIP demands, or a benchmark dental benefit plan.

States are also needed to publish a listing of all getting involved Medicaid and CHIP dental providers and advantage plans on . States have versatility to establish what oral benefits are supplied to grown-up Medicaid enrollees. While many states supply at the very least emergency situation oral solutions for grownups, much less than fifty percent of the states currently supply comprehensive dental care.




The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) is devoted to improving accessibility to dental and oral health solutions for recipients signed up in Medicaid and CHIP. In 2010, CMS established an Oral Health Effort (OHI) to enhance kids's access to ideal precautionary oral care by dealing with states, federal partners, the oral service provider neighborhood, and supporters.


In 2023, CMS convened a specialist workgroup to provide input on critical priorities for the following stage of the OHI. The workgroup suggested that CMS expand the OHI to work with oral wellness accessibility, high quality, and results throughout the lifespan, with a concentrate on: raising an emphasis on preventative, minimally invasive, and timely treatment; boosting managed treatment strategy involvement and liability; andenhancing capability for quality dimension and data analytics.
